Transaction 2c4d59f308150fbf08ffb03eee685f21a24e03332d41e3d56bb76d532a8cc408
1 Input
1 Output
-
2c4d59f308150fbf08ffb03eee685f21a24e03332d41e3d56bb76d532a8cc408:0
- value
- 2064514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22a491e6a7fbe675e36b5e15010aa8c191b1a0a0 OP_EQUAL
- address
- 34rC3asq8eRtdMMXW4Z5XfavRtwBCLQxEe